Advance your art in metal. Produce extraordinary prints in any of these ways:
- Etch your designs into metal plate.
- Produce fine drawings in watercolor or India ink using the aquatint method.
- Delineate beautiful shapes and shades by hand-tooling or burnishing metal plates (the mezzotint technique).
- Use the drypoint technique, with only a sharp-pointed needle, to cut fine lines on copper.
- Use intaglio printmaking, the reproduction process using a plate with sunken letters and designs.
This comprehensive course includes tips on selecting the proper metal, and on preparation, proofing, and printing. There are 209 illustrations to guide you.
